152 /*
|
|
153 * The determination of the sendfile() "nbytes bug" is complex enough.
|
|
154 * There are two sendfile() syscalls: a new #393 has no bug while
|
|
155 * an old #336 has the bug in some versions and has not in others.
|
|
156 * Besides libc_r wrapper also emulates the bug in some versions.
|
|
157 * There is no way to say exactly if syscall #336 in FreeBSD circa 4.6
|
|
158 * has the bug. We use the algorithm that is correct at least for
|
|
159 * RELEASEs and for syscalls only (not libc_r wrapper).
|
|
160 *
|
|
161 * 4.6.1-RELEASE and below have the bug
|
|
162 * 4.6.2-RELEASE and above have the new syscall
|
|
163 *
|
|
164 * We detect the new sendfile() syscall available at the compile time
|
|
165 * to allow an old binary to run correctly on an updated FreeBSD system.
|
|
166 */
